Common Ignition Problems and Diagnosis

Understanding typical ignition-related problems can assist car owners interact successfully with specialists and make notified decisions. A few of these issues include:

  • Faulty Ignition Coils: These convert battery voltage into the high voltage required to fire up fuel. Symptoms often consist of engine misfires or hard starts.

  • Bad Spark Plugs: Worn-out or malfunctioning trigger plugs can lead to ignition concerns, leading to trouble beginning the engine and poor efficiency.

  • Ignition Switch Problems: If the ignition switch fails, the car may not start. This problem can be indicated by electrical devices malfunctioning when the key is turned.

  • Worn Timing Components: Issues with the timing belt or chain can cause ignition timing problems, affecting engine efficiency.

  • Faulty Sensors: Modern cars use numerous sensing units (e.g., crankshaft position sensors) that are important for the ignition system. Malfunctioning sensors can lead to starting problems.
